Iran - Malaria Cases Reported
Since 2013, Iran Malaria Cases Reported was down by 100% year on year. At 0 Cases in 2018, the country was number 100 among other countries in Malaria Cases Reported. Democratic Republic of the Congo ranked the highest with 18,356,636.95 Cases in 2019, an increase of 8.2% compared to 2018. Nigeria, Burkina Faso and Mozambique resp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Nicaragua recorded the best 5 years average growth at +67.1% per year, while East Timor was the worst growing country at -100% per year.
